Protein Consumption Must Be Balanced with Other Nutrients for Good Health
Although it is an important component, protein should not be consumed alone. A balanced nutrition regime requires protein consumption to be combined with other vital components including carbohydrate consumption, healthy fat consumption, vitamin, and mineral consumption.
The consumption of vegetables, wholegrain foods, and good sources of healthy fats such as nuts and seeds improves the process of digestion and provides energy. The consumption of other nutrients also ensures that one does not experience fatigue. For individuals who are always busy, concentrating on food consumption as a whole is advisable.
What Is So Special About the Protein-Rich Diet for Professionals?
Protein consumption is essential not only in maintaining physical well-being but also in supporting intellectual activity. Unlike carbohydrates, protein takes longer to digest and, therefore, makes one feel full for a longer period of time.
The advantages of the protein-rich diet include:
● Better muscle growth and recovery
● Metabolism boost
● Reduction in the amount of junk food consumed
● Performance improvement
For professionals lacking energy during the course of the day, it is recommended to consume more protein-rich products.
Protein Needs: Daily Requirements
The amount of protein needed depends on various factors including age, physical activities, and exercise. On average, a person needs approximately 0.8 to 1 grams of protein for each kilogram of body weight. For those who want to lose weight, gain muscles, and exercise frequently, more proteins are needed.
For instance:
● Sedentary people: Normal protein intake
● Professional workers: More protein intake
● People who focus on fitness: Even more protein intake
What matters most is distributing protein intake during the day and not taking it in one go.
High-Protein Diet Plan for an Average Workday
Creating a viable dietary plan is necessary for maintaining a healthy routine. Here’s how a simple yet effective diet plan for professionals working in Delhi NCR may look like:
Breakfast:
Cooked eggs or paneer bhurji with whole wheat bread
Greek yogurt with fruit and nuts
Mid-Morning Snack:
A handful of almonds/walnuts
Protein shake
Lunch:
Grilled chicken or paneer along with brown rice and vegetables
Dal/chawal/roti with salad
Evening Snack:
Roasted chana or salad made out of sprouts
Buttermilk/Green Tea
Dinner:
Simple and healthy dinner based on fish, tofu or lentils with vegetables
High Protein Foods Readily Available in Delhi NCR
To stay healthy, you need not go for exotic food items but there are plenty of local foods that you can consider to have a high protein diet.
Some of these include:
● Chicken and Eggs
● Paneer and Tofu
● Dal, Chana, Rajma
● Greek Yogurt and Milk
● Nuts and Seeds
Such foods are readily available to everyone.
High-Protein Diet Mistakes to Watch Out For
Although raising your intake of proteins is great for you, improper execution can result in imbalances.
Mistakes that people make:
● Disregarding other important nutrients such as fiber and healthy fats
● Eating too much processed proteins
● Missing out on meals and drinking shakes exclusively
● Neglecting hydration
The healthier option is always a more moderate one.

High Protein Diet as an Aid for Losing Weight and Getting Fit
One of the benefits of protein is its function in the process of fat burning and muscle preservation. First of all, the high satiety effect of protein decreases caloric intake without feeling any hunger or deprivation.
At the same time, protein is important in muscle preservation when losing weight, which means that the body will burn more fat than muscle tissue. This effect may be enhanced by working out.
